Best Online Resources for Learning Obd2 Diagnostics and Troubleshooting

Learning about OBD2 diagnostics and troubleshooting is essential for automotive enthusiasts, students, and professionals alike. The internet offers a wealth of resources to help you understand vehicle diagnostics, interpret error codes, and perform troubleshooting effectively. Here are some of the best online resources to enhance your knowledge and skills in OBD2 diagnostics.

Online Courses and Tutorials

Structured learning is available through various online platforms. Websites like Udemy, Coursera, and YouTube host comprehensive courses and tutorials on OBD2 diagnostics. These courses often include video demonstrations, quizzes, and practical tips to help you grasp complex concepts quickly.

Official and Manufacturer Resources

Many vehicle manufacturers and diagnostic tool companies provide official manuals, guides, and tutorials. Websites such as OBDLink, Autel, and Snap-on offer detailed documentation and troubleshooting guides tailored to specific vehicle brands and diagnostic tools.

Online Forums and Communities

Participating in online forums can be incredibly helpful. Communities like OBD-II.com, Stack Exchange’s Motor Vehicle Maintenance & Repair, and Reddit’s r/AutoRepair provide platforms to ask questions, share experiences, and learn from seasoned professionals and hobbyists.

Diagnostic Software and Tools

Many websites offer free and paid diagnostic software that can be used with OBD2 scanners. Tools like OBD Auto Doctor, ScanTool.net, and Torque provide software for diagnosing vehicle issues, reading error codes, and performing live data analysis.

Additional Resources

Blogs, eBooks, and YouTube channels dedicated to automotive diagnostics can supplement your learning. Popular channels like ChrisFix and EricTheCarGuy offer hands-on tutorials that demonstrate troubleshooting techniques in real-world scenarios.
